Fall River recreates a notorious incident in Fall River, Massachusetts: the trial of a Methodist minister for the murder of a pregnant mill worker whom it was suspected he had seduced. The work offers a view of the lives of poor factory girls and clerical corruption in early New England industrial towns.

An account of the circumstances leading to the trial of the Rev. Ephraim K. Avery for the murder of Sarah M. Cornell in Fall River in December 1832
